Output 76a3e766bf49b0e36ffcd8636cf546f8a4bf1908e176139fdc42e508ba38a7d7:0

value
132959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8553ac92e8a4ed6541766a7c97cd318d7516a906 OP_EQUAL
address
3Dqz2qV51YrrgMUp81rBEfLoDS3iX1Uxvh
transaction
76a3e766bf49b0e36ffcd8636cf546f8a4bf1908e176139fdc42e508ba38a7d7
confirmations
228241
spent
true